Why do Japanese students wear uniforms?

The majority of Japan’s junior high and high schools require students to wear uniforms. The Japanese school uniform is not only a symbol of youth but also plays an important role in the country’s culture, as they are felt to help instill a sense of discipline and community among youth.

Are schools strict in Japan?

The students in Japanese schools are generally better behaved and there are far fewer discipline problems than in the United States. Studies have also shown that Japanese students on average spend about one-third more time learning each class period than American students do.

Why are Japanese school uniforms so short?

Unlike what people might imagine, most schools have a skirt below the knee. What happens is that the Japanese themselves roll up the skirt in order to shorten it, for the same reasons that Western girls wear short clothes, for comfort, fashion and presentation.

How does dating in Japan work?

But most Americans go on a date in pairs rather than groups. In Japan, group dating — or goukon — commonly happens first. It’s a way to gauge mutual interest and suitability, as well as mix with a potential partner’s friends. You might think that this sounds low-pressure compared with American dating customs.

What did the Japanese boys wear to school?

One of the noticeable influences was in the transformation of Japanese school uniforms. Boys started to wear a uniform called a gakuran. It was made up of a hat, a black top with a stand-up collar, five golden buttons, and black straight-legged pants.

What do Japanese middle school uniforms look like?

Even today, a lot of Japanese middle school uniforms have a high collar and are in the sailor style. However, there are also schools that switch to blazers, as many go abroad for school trips and the high collar looks too much like a military uniform. “From the 1920s, girls’ uniforms sported a shorter top combined with a long skirt.
